They all got their start as TV unknowns. Now Jessica Mauboy, Guy Sebastian and Delta Goodrem will be the biggest stars on Australian television’s night of nights.
Mauboy and Sebastian, who both rose to fame on the TV talent search Australian Idol, and Goodrem, who won our hearts as Nina Tucker on long-running soap Neighbours, will perform at the Logies at The Star on the Gold Coast on June 30.
With more than 20 albums and 150 hit singles between them, and each with an ARIA Award, the hotly anticipated performances will add some buzz to the annual event.
Mauboy, who first graced our screens auditioning for Idol judges Mark Holden, Ian “Dicko” Dickson and Marcia Hines as a 16-year-old in Alice Springs, said while her TV moment back in 2006 catapulted her to stardom, she would have been just as content living a simpler life.
“I often think back to my moment in Idol,” Mauboy said.

“There would always have been music in my life, but without Idol maybe the road would have taken me to being a music teacher in Darwin, an equally good choice.”
The popular songstress is poised to perform a deeply emotional and personal number from her upcoming fourth studio album when she sings at the awards.
“For the Logies I will perform my new single and when I co-wrote it I knew it would be hard to perform live. It’s a big emotional mountain to climb because it’s so personal,” she said. “June 30 will be a big night, a big coming of age for me and my music.
“I last performed in 2017 on the Logies stage and it was honestly the TV performance of my career I enjoyed the most, so this is a real home coming.”
Having all been signed with Sony since they entered the music industry, the trio share a special bond. While they will all perform individually, Mauboy dreams of one day sharing the stage with her colleagues.
“Guy and Delta have always been amazing role models,” she said. “The three of us have all been on the same label all our recording career so we have meet at a lot of events, concerts and showcases.
“What I have learnt from them both is talent will get you in the door but character will get you to the finish line. It’s weird we all have our own creative lane ways but there is a deep understanding and huge respect. The one piece of unfinished business I have with both is to co-write and record a song, a duet with each of them. It will happen, the stars will align.”
The 61st TV WEEK Logie Awards will take place on Sunday, June 30, at The Star Gold Coast in Queensland. All the action from the red-carpet arrivals and awards-show celebrations will be telecast on Nine Network and 9Now.
